Role Overview

Nexilis is seeking a proactive and detail-driven Operations Manager to oversee the coordination between engineering, manufacturing, procurement, logistics, and sales. This role is critical to ensure timely, high-quality, and efficient execution across all functional teams.

The Operations Manager will act as the execution backbone of the company — driving structure, accountability, and efficiency as Nexilis scales its AI solutions and edge vision products.

Key Responsibilities

1. Project Execution & Coordination

  • Create and track detailed project timelines for R&D, production, and delivery.
  • Liaise between engineering, manufacturing, and business teams to ensure smooth information flow.
  • Maintain delivery schedules, track dependencies, and flag risks early.
  • Lead weekly project review meetings with action follow-ups.

2. Process & Efficiency Management

  • Document and standardize operational workflows (assembly, QA, testing, logistics).
  • Implement metrics and dashboards to measure team productivity.
  • Drive process automation where possible (inventory, scheduling, reporting).

3. Vendor & Supply Chain Coordination

  • Manage vendor relationships for components, fabrication, and assembly.
  • Track purchase orders, incoming inventory, and component forecasts.
  • Ensure timely procurement and optimize cost efficiency.

4. Customer Delivery & Quality

  • Coordinate product readiness and delivery milestones for customer pilots.
  • Track customer feedback and work with QA to drive continuous improvement.
  • Support installation and testing coordination with technical teams.

KPIs

  • On-time project completion (% adherence to timeline).
  • Operational efficiency improvements (process time reduction, cost savings).
  • Vendor performance metrics (quality, lead time adherence).
  • Delivery quality score (customer satisfaction post-deployment).

Qualifications & Skills

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Operations Management (MBA preferred).
  • 6–10 years of experience in tech hardware / electronics / IoT / product manufacturing.
  • Strong project management and coordination skills.
  • Familiar with tools: Asana / Monday.com / Google Sheets / ERP systems.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management ability.

Compensation

  • ₹10–15 LPA base salary.
  • Performance bonus linked to delivery efficiency & on-time completion.
